Practical Techniques to Cultivate Positivity ✅
Daily Affirmations
Start your day with positive affirmations. These are simple, powerful statements that reinforce your desired beliefs and goals. Repeat them regularly, and feel the impact on your mindset. For example, "I am capable and confident," or "I attract positive opportunities into my life."
Gratitude Journaling
Take a few minutes each day to write down things you're grateful for. This simple practice shifts your focus from what's lacking to what's abundant in your life. It fosters appreciation and boosts overall happiness.
Visualization
Use your imagination to create vivid mental images of your desired future. Visualize yourself achieving your goals, overcoming challenges, and living your best life. This technique helps to build confidence and motivation.
Mindfulness Meditation
Practice mindfulness meditation to become more aware of your thoughts and emotions. This allows you to observe them without judgment and to consciously choose positive thoughts over negative ones. Even a few minutes of daily meditation can make a significant difference.
Reframing Negative Thoughts
Learn to challenge and reframe negative thoughts. Ask yourself if there's another way to interpret the situation, or if the thought is based on facts or assumptions. Often, you can find a more positive and empowering perspective.
Overcoming Negative Thought Patterns 💡
Identify Your Triggers
Pay attention to the situations, people, or events that trigger negative thoughts. Once you identify your triggers, you can develop strategies to manage them more effectively.
Challenge Negative Self-Talk
Become aware of your inner critic and challenge its negative pronouncements. Ask yourself if the self-talk is accurate, helpful, or kind. Replace negative self-talk with positive and encouraging affirmations.
Practice Self-Compassion
Treat yourself with the same kindness and understanding you would offer a friend. When you make mistakes or face challenges, avoid self-criticism and instead focus on learning and growth.
Surround Yourself with Positivity
Limit your exposure to negative influences, such as negative news, toxic relationships, or pessimistic people. Instead, seek out positive and supportive environments and relationships. Learn about managing toxic relationships here.
Embrace Imperfection
Accept that you're not perfect and that mistakes are a natural part of life. Don't let the fear of failure hold you back from pursuing your goals. Focus on progress, not perfection.

Is positive thinking a substitute for professional help?
Positive thinking can be a valuable tool for improving mental well-being, but it's not a substitute for professional help. If you're struggling with anxiety, depression, or other mental health issues, seek guidance from a qualified therapist or counselor.
